Several tools for predicting the likelihood of non-sentinel lymph node (non-SLN) involvement in SLN-positive breast cancer patients have been created so far. The aim of our study was to create and ...validate different nomograms for predicting the likelihood of non-SLN involvement that would be applicable in different institutions and that would also include the results of the preoperative US examination of the axilla. From January 2000 to January 2009, 534 breast cancer patients underwent axillary lymph node dissection (ALND) due to metastatic SLN at our institution. Using logistic regression results three nomograms differing in the inclusion of the results of intraoperative examination of SLN were created. The nomograms were validated using bootstrap methods. In all three nomograms, US examination of the axilla was a powerful independent variable. Other variables included (different in different nomograms) were tumor size, lymphovascular invasion, metastasis size in SLN, number of negative and number of positive SLNs. Mean absolute error and mean area under the ROC curve equals to 0.016 and 0.77 for the first, 0.023 and 0.75 for the second and 0.014 and 0.79 for the third nomogram. Three nomograms for predicting the likelihood of non-SLN metastases including the results of the preoperative US examination of the axilla were created at our institution. They differ in the inclusion of the results of intraoperative examination of SLNs and are thus applicable in different institutions. The validation results seem promising and omission of completion ALND might be considered in patients with the probability of having non-SLN metastases of 10% or less.
In Slovenia like in other countries, till recently, personal history of epithelial ovarian cancer (EOC) has not been included among indications for genetic counselling. Recent studies reported up to ...17% rate of germinal BRCA1/2 mutation (gBRCA1/2m) within the age group under 50 years at diagnosis. The original aim of this study was to invite to the genetic counselling still living patients with EOC under 45 years, to offer gBRCA1/2m testing and to perform analysis of gBRCA1/2m rate and of clinico-pathologic characteristics. Later, we added also the data of previously genetically tested patients with EOC aged 45 to 49 years.
All clinical data have to be interpreted in the light of many changes happened in the field of EOC just in the last few years: new hystology stage classification (FIGO), new hystology types and differentiation grades classification, new therapeutic possibilities (PARP inhibitors available, also in Slovenia) and new guidelines for genetic counselling of EOC patients (National Comprehensive Cancer Network, NCCN), together with next-generation sequencing possibilities.
Compliance rate at the invitation was 43.1%. In the group of 27 invited or previously tested patients with EOC diagnosed before the age of 45 years, five gBRCA1/2 mutations were found. The gBRCA1/2m detection rate within the group was 18.5%. There were 4 gBRCA1 and 1 gBRCA2 mutations detected. In the extended group of 42 tested patients with EOC diagnosed before the age of 50 years, 14 gBRCA1/2 mutations were found. The gBRCA1/2m detection rate within this extended, partially selected group was 33.3%. There were 11 gBRCA1 and 3 gBRCA2 mutations detected.
The rate of gBRCA1/2 mutation in tested unselected EOC patients under the age of 50 years was higher than 10%, namely 18.5%. Considering also a direct therapeuthic benefit of PARP inhibitors for BRCA positive patients, there is a double reason to offer genetic testing to all EOC patients younger than 50 years. Regarding clinical data, it is important to perform their re-interpretation in everyday clinical practice, because this may influence therapeutic possibilities to be offered.
Background
Touch imprint cytology (TIC) is a fast, cheap and specific intraoperative examination of the sentinel lymph nodes (SLNs) in early breast cancer patients. The results of TIC in patients ...with ultrasonically (US) uninvolved axillary lymph nodes are not known. The objective of our study was to compare the results of TIC in the patients with US uninvolved axillary lymph nodes (US group) and those with only clinically uninvolved axillary lymph nodes (non-US group).
Methods
A total of 470 patients were included in the study, 257 in the US group and 213 in the non-US group. TIC results were compared to the definite histology, and the sensitivity of TIC was calculated for both groups of patients. A subgroup analysis of TIC findings with regard to the primary tumor size was performed.
Results
Overall sensitivity and sensitivity for detecting macrometastases was significantly lower in the US group compared with the non-US group. In the US group, TIC results changed the course of treatment in 9% of patients, while in the non-US group, the course of treatment was changed in 22% of patients. In the non-US group, the proportion of positive TIC results increased with increasing tumor size, whereas in the US group it did not.
Conclusion
The sensitivity of TIC is lower in the patients with US uninvolved axillary lymph nodes compared to those with only clinically uninvolved axillary lymph nodes. TIC might not be indicated in patients with US uninvolved axillary lymph nodes as it changes the course of treatment in only 9% of patients.
Purpose
To determine whether the absence of post-treatment changes in the negative sentinel lymph nodes (SLN) in the neoadjuvant setting for biopsy-proven cN + disease results in an increased ...regional recurrence (RR) rate in patients after SLN biopsy (SLNB) only.
Methods
Breast cancer patients with biopsy-proven cN + disease who converted to node-negative disease after neoadjuvant systemic treatment (NAST) and underwent SLNB only were included. Retrospective analysis was performed for patients diagnosed between 2008 and 2021. Pathohistological specimens were reviewed for the presence of post-treatment changes in the SLNs. Patients with negative SLNs (ypN0) were divided into two groups: (i) with post-treatment changes, (ii) without post-treatment changes. Patients’ characteristics were compared between groups. Crude RR rates were compared using the log-rank test. Recurrence-free (RFS) and overall survival (OS) for the entire cohort were calculated using Kaplan–Meier.
Results
Of 437 patients with cN + disease, 95 underwent SLNB only. 82 were ypN0, 57 with post-treatment changes (group 1), 25 without post-treatment changes (group 2). During the median follow-up of 37 months (range 6–148), 1 isolated regional recurrence occurred in group 2 (RR rate 0% for group 1 vs. 4% for group 2,
p
= 0.149). There were no differences in 3-year RFS and OS between groups.
Conclusion
Absent post-treatment changes in negative SLNs for biopsy-proven cN + disease that covert to node-negative after NAST did not result in increased regional recurrence rates in our cohort. Multidisciplinary input is essential to determine whether additional treatment is needed in these patients.
Purpose
Lateral neck nodal metastases are common in patients with differentiated thyroid cancer (DTC) and usually have an indolent nature. They may be detected via neck palpation or preoperative ...ultrasound (US) of the neck. We hypothesized that preoperative neck metastases detected with US did not affect regional recurrence or long-term survival.
Methods
A retrospective analysis of patients’ records treated for DTC at our institution between January 2006 and December 2016 was performed. Information about preoperative US of the neck, treatment, demographics, staging, and histopathology was obtained. The endpoints for the study were nodal recurrence and survival. Differences in survival were analyzed between three groups of patients divided by presence or lack of preoperative US and/or palpable cervical lymph nodes (PLN). Furthermore, the prognostic value of multiple variables was tested by univariate and multivariate analysis.
Results
There were 1108 patients with DTC, 221 males and 887 females. The median age was 48.3 years (range 3 to 86), the median time of observation was 68 months (range 0 to 142). Eight hundred sixty-two patients without PLN or preoperative US represented group 1, 112 patients with PLN were in group 2, and 134 patients without PLN and with preoperative US were in group 3. Only five patients had a regional recurrence, one died due to distant metastases. There was no statistically significant difference in survival between the groups (p = 0.841) and neck US was not significantly associated with overall survival neither in univariate nor in multivariate analysis.
Conclusion
In patients with DTC, the benefits of preoperative US of cervical lymph nodes are probably limited and “less is more” approach is advised.
Intraoperative touch imprint cytology (ITIC) is used for intraoperative detection of sentinel lymph node (SLN) metastases with intention to spare the patients another surgery. However, ITIC prolongs ...surgery, and ads costs. It is less likely positive in breast cancer (BC) patients after neoadjuvant chemotherapy (NAC) due to low axillary tumor burden. We aimed to evaluate ITIC in patients after NAC and assess how often it changes the ongoing surgery.
BC patients treated with NAC followed by surgery at the Institute of Oncology Ljubljana, Slovenia, from January 2008 to July 2020 with ITIC performed were selected for analysis. Sensitivity, specificity, and the proportion of positive ITIC were calculated for different subgroups.
Overall, 144 patients were identified. 73 of 144 (50.7%) patients were N0 before NAC and 71 of 144 (49.3%) were initially N1 and downstaged to N0 after NAC. ITIC was positive in 30 of 144 (20.8%) of patients, 7 of 73 (9.6%) in N0 group and 23 of 71 (32.4%) in N1 group. In N0 group, ITIC was positive in 1 of 20 (5%) if the tumor size was ≤ 20 mm after NAC, and 2 of 39 (5.1%) if the tumor was triple negative (TN) or Her-2+. In the N1 group ITIC was positive in > 20% in all subgroups. The sensitivity and specificity of ITIC was 50.8% and 100%, respectively and did not differ between groups.
ITIC after NAC is accurate with comparable sensitivity to ITIC in upfront surgery. We suggest omission of ITIC after NAC in initially N0 patients, particularly for tumors ≤ 20 mm after NAC, and in TN or Her-2+ subtypes.
